I found a better case for the Zoomer than the leather one from Radio
Shack. The one from Radio Shack is more like a cover. Anyway, I was a
K-Mart in the electronics department and found a very nice case that fits
the Zoomer like a glove. It one of their camara cases called "Sport
Zone". It is very nicely padded to protect the Zoomer and has an good
sized pocket for PCards, small pocket modem, serial cable, and etc. It
was only $9.00 and has a sholder strap that can be removed. They also
come in different colors.
